Movie theaters are a popular pastime for many people, but the seating arrangements and distances between seats can vary significantly. Depending on the size and type of theater, some seats may be close together while others may be far apart.
In most modern theaters, there is usually a standard distance of one meter (3 feet, 3 inches) between each row of seats. This allows people to comfortably sit in their assigned seat while still having enough space to reach over to grab snacks or drinks from the concession stand. However, this distance can vary depending on the theater’s layout and the type of seating available.
Theaters that feature stadium-style seating will often have more space between rows than traditional flat theaters.
This is due to the fact that in stadium-style seating, each row of seats is slightly elevated from the one below it. This allows for better sightlines and improved acoustics but also increases the distance between each row of seats.
Another factor that can affect how far apart movie theater seats are is whether or not they are reclining chairs or regular chairs. Reclining chairs tend to take up more space due to their increased width when fully reclined. This means that there will be more space between each row of reclining chairs than if they were regular chairs.
Finally, some theaters may also have specialized “luxury” seating such as couches or loveseats which generally offer more space than regular theater seating. These types of seating options usually come at a premium price but can provide a more comfortable viewing experience.
